Jewish settlers led by Etzion storm Al-Aqsa courtyards

Sunday 13-December-2020

Dozens of Jewish settlers resumed on Sunday morning their forced entry into the courtyards of the holy Al-Aqsa Mosque and performed Talmudic rituals celebrating the Jewish festival called Hanukkah under Israeli police protection.

Jerusalemite sources reported that 130 settlers including 40 students of extremist religious institutes stormed the courtyards of the Al-Aqsa Mosque in the morning period of the daily incursions.

The Israeli police closed the Maghareba Gate after the end of the morning incursions while they continued to evacuate the eastern area of the Mosque and the al-Rahma Gate prayer hall during the settlers’ incursions.

In a continuous escalation against Al-Aqsa settlers led by the extremist Yehuda Etzion sat down at the yards of the al-Silsila Gate area in Al-Aqsa as part of their Talmudic rituals.

Etzion raised a miniature for the alleged temple in front of a group of settlers inside the Al-Aqsa Mosque.

Etzion had planned to blow up the Dome of the Rock in the 80s of the last century and established an underground terrorist organization toward that end.

The settler incursions are part of periodic tours aiming to change the fait accompli in the Holy City and Al-Aqsa Mosque.

During the evening incursions the Israeli police provided the settlers an additional half hour between 12:30 and 2:00 instead of 1:30.

The head of the Islamic Supreme Authority in Jerusalem and the preacher of the Al-Aqsa Mosque Sheikh Ikrimah Sabri warned of the seriousness of the recent request of the extremist Jewish groups. They asked to build a Talmudic school in the eastern square of Al-Aqsa to gain a foothold in it after they failed to control and convert the al-Rahma Gate to a synagogue

Sheikh Sabri warned that the occupation is trying to take away the powers of the endowments in Al-Aqsa and gradually take control of the Holy City.

He pointed out that the temporal and spatial division policy that the occupation is trying to impose began decades ago but Jerusalemites and the Palestinians in 1948 Occupied Palestine responded to that scheme and foiled it.
